The science of foods and the nutrients they contain, and of their actions within the body . Includes the social, economic, cultural and psychological implications of food and eating. Food choices: preferences - taste, habit, tradition, social interactions, availability, convenience, economy, positive/negative associations, emotions (shorter sleep more weight gained) Values (some people will not just eat something: body weight/image, health bene ts. Macronutrients (energy - yielding: carbohydrates (macronutrients (energy - yielding)) - organic, fats (macronutrients (energy - yielding)) - organic, proteins (macronutrients (energy - yielding)) - organic, vitamins (micronutrients) - organic. Wednesday, september 7, 2016: minerals (micronutrients) - inorganic, water - inorganic +the only thing u really need for a day. Energy - yielding nutrients (kcal = cal: carbohydrates 4 kcal/g, fat 9 kcal/g, protein 4 kcal/g. Foods that contains - 5g carbo, 5g protein, 5g fat. (5x4) + (5x9) + (5x4) = 85 kcal.
